Publisher Description:
Ballistic glass delamination creates spots, bubbles, and discoloration on the windshields of U.S. Marine Corps tactical vehicles, impairing driver visibility. To address this issue, RAND researchers use a simulation model to estimate the effects of delamination on future sustainment costs and vehicle availability under various repair and replacement scenarios and identify steps that the Marine Corps could take to mitigate the associated risks.
